Sylvia L. Burch was born September 4, 1950 to Willie and Allean (Young) Butler in Orangeburg, South Carolina She was a woman of great faith and demonstrated a very fervent prayer life which oftentimes would be on intercession of others. She was a member and church mother of United Kingdom International Church under the leadership of her son and daughter in law Apostle Howard and Lady Machell Proctor. Family time was everything to her as her family was everything to her. She was always positive in any situation. She was always seen smiling and making others smile. She loved to teach kids how to read and she enjoyed sewing, dancing and various arts and crafts. In her downtime, she could be found watching movies on the Hallmark and Food Network channels. She was a great cook and was known for her cookies and biscuits.
Sylvia answered the call from the Lord on June 29, 2025 and leaves fond cherishing memories to her husband Charles Burch; daughter Cheryl (Allen) Mayes; son Apostle Howard (Machell) Proctor; brothers Benny (Francine) Butler, Tommie (Regina) Butler, Johnny Butler and Kelvin Pinkey; sisters Leticia Butler and Melissa Butler; seven grandchildren, one great grandchild and a host of loving extended family and friends.
